Rollback was initiated at 14:41, but cached solver states persisted in the Lattice queue until 15:06, so stale timetables reached three department heads. We confirmed the regression stems from commit-level reordering of the preference matrix, not solver logic itself. For verification during review, the offending build is identified by the token below.

trace token, fafog-kageg: htk4_98e6

Welcome to the Ledgerline billing worker team. We run blue-green deploys: two identical worker fleets behind the Penrose job router, with traffic cut over only after the idle fleet drains a shadow queue cleanly. Reviewers should confirm that any migration in a PR is backward-compatible, since both fleets briefly process jobs against the same schema. Cutover is triggered by pushing a signed release manifest to the router's control channel. Manifests are signed with the deploy key that follows.

rollout seal: bky3_Zik

Handover — Joint Venture Proposal

From: M. Arkwright, outgoing. To: J. Fenlow, incoming.

Status: the Tolvane Industries JV proposal is at term-sheet stage. Counsel has flagged two IP clauses; revisions due next week. Board vote targeted for month-end. Keep Halden briefed, avoid committing capital figures verbally. All board materials are drafted. Context on our wider intentions is set out in the note below.

management briefing: Project Ulavan slips by two quarters because of the staffing delay.